当前位置:首页  通知公告

HPC-4作业提交

一.申请计算账户

在门户网站-服务大厅,提交“高性能计算平台账户开通申请”流程(流程网址:https://service.buct.edu.cn/newservice/fe/taskCenter/matterApplication?app_id=252)。

二.Web作业提交方法

  1. 用统一身份认证账户密码登录https://hpccloud.buct.edu.cn

  2. 上传输入文件

选择集群、作业提交、public_cluster、项目目录后,弹出文件传输对话框,可执行上传、下载、创建目录、删除文件等操作,share文件夹是共享文件夹。

  1. 提交作业

选择提交作业的模板、输入作业名称(自拟)、选择输入文件,按提交作业按钮。

  1. 查看作业

在“作业”栏选中要查看的作业



在性能监控页,查看资源使用情况



在作业输出页,查看控制台输出内容和错误日志

  1. 定制作业脚本

平台提供了各计算软件的作业模板,作业提交队列是公共队列,当用户有私有队,用户可以编写自己的脚本模板。

三、控制台作业提交方法

  1. 用统一身份认证账户密码登录https://hpccloud.buct.edu.cn,右上角修改密码,写原密码就可以,此操作使控制台登录密码生效。

  2. 远程登录(SSH

下载xshell软件或其他SSH软件,https://hpc.buct.edu.cn/2021/0708/c1071a155120/page.htm

登录IP地址:121.195.154.219

登录端口:4999

用户名:“u”+“学工号”  如u2025****

密码:统一身份认证密码

  1. 提交作业SLURM作业调度系统脚本模板在~/share/job-template目录

1)在根目录编辑脚本 vi submit.slurm    i进入编辑状态;esc退出编辑状态;“:wq”保存退出)
#SBATCH -q cpu           
(队列或分区名:
cpu

#SBATCH -o %J.out         (输出文件)

#SBATCH -e %J.err         (错误文件)

#SBATCH -N 1              (申请节点数)

#SBATCH --ntasks-per-node=64   (单个节点使用核心数)

echo start: `date +'%Y-%m-%d %T'`     (作业执行起始时间,可省去)

start=`date +%s`

########################################################

export g16root=/groups/public_cluster/home/share/ (环境变量)

export PATH=$g16root/g16:$PATH

export GAUSS_PDEF=${SLURM_CPUS_PER_TASK}

export GAUSS_SCRDIR=$SLURM_SUBMIT_DIR

source $g16root/g16/bsd/g16.profile

g16  input.gjf                  (执行命令)   

########################################################

echo end: `date +'%Y-%m-%d %T'`        (作业执行结束时间,可省去)

end=`date +%s`

echo TIME:`expr $end - $start`s



2)上传输入文件,一个作业一个文件夹

3)拷贝脚本    cp submit.slurm  文件夹名

4)修改文件夹中脚本的参数:如核心数和输入文件名

5)提交作业    sbatch submit.slurm

6)查看作业    squeue

7)取消作业    scancel <jobid>